In Like Flynn: Baseball Cats Make SEC Tourney

After a 9-0 drubbing of Ole Miss, our Battling Bat Cats have fought their way into the SEC Tournament. Placing third in the SEC East -- where (I believe) 4 of the 6 teams have been in the top-25 this year -- is an incredible feat.

If you're in Lex, you can see the Wildcat baseball team in their final game of the season on Saturday at 1PM at Cliff Hagan Field. Ramel Bradley will be throwing out the first pitch.
